According to the Bush Foundation website, "Nathan Caleb Johnson
sees a deep need for people of color to have a more equitable role
in creating buildings and spaces in their communities. He wants
design and construction processes to change to be more inclusive
and to have greater economic impact for communities of color."
Johnson is a partner in 4RM+ULA (pronounced “formula”), a
MNUCP certified minority (African American)-owned architecture
and design firm from Saint Paul, Minn. 4RM+ULA is providing
design, placement and layout for the downtown Rochester Bus
Rapid Transit (BRT) station platforms.

The USA flag proudly waves in the wind in front of One Discovery Square (right) and Discovery Square
Phase 2 (left building behind trees) currently being constructed. The topping off ceremony was held March 1,
2021. The project has Buy American Steel requirements. The steel was purchased through woman-owned
Top Iron Reinforcing and manufactured/fabricated at Ambassador Steel Fabrication, also woman-owned..
